Shannon Sharpe Faces $50M Sexual Assault Lawsuit, ESPN Return Uncertain
Shannon Sharpe has temporarily stepped away from his ESPN duties following multiple sexual assault allegations, including a $50 million civil lawsuit, which he categorically denies, asserting the relationships were consensual. His lawyer has released text messages to support his defense, while the accuser’s attorney has circulated an audio clip purportedly involving Sharpe. Stephen A. Smith, Sharpe’s on-air partner and executive producer at ESPN, has publicly expressed hope for Sharpe’s return before the NFL season, but acknowledges that the court of public opinion and Disney’s concerns may complicate his comeback. ESPN has supported Sharpe’s decision to step away but has not committed to his return, leaving his future at the network uncertain. Despite Sharpe’s and Smith’s optimism, internal sources indicate that a return is not guaranteed as Disney weighs reputational risks. Ultimately, the decision will rest with Disney, and the situation remains unresolved as legal proceedings continue.
